Oem plug wires
 
My wires are new looking and numbered are they the original/ Oem Delphi's trying to decide whether or not to replace them. I changed the plugs& cap & rotor the terminals were corroded. The truck runs excellent,idles smooth & steady, just want to max out fuel mileage ! And curious if the wires were original from 2000. Any thoughts ???

swartlkk 11-19-2008 07:15 AM

RE: Oem plug wires
 
Probably original.

To assess whether they need to be replaced or not, take a clean spray bottle (one that can mist pretty good). Fill it with water. With the engine running and the truck located someplace dark, turn off all exterior lights and mist down the engine. If you see blue shots of light, the wires are leaking current and need to be replaced. If it stays dark, you do not need to replace a thing.
